Replacing the front audio and USB assembly

Attention:
Do not open your computer or attempt any repair before reading and understanding the "Important safety information"
in the ThinkCentre Safety and Warranty Guide that came with your computer. To obtain a copy of the ThinkCentre
Safety and Warranty Guide, go to:
http://support.lenovo.com
This section provides instructions on how to replace the front audio and USB assembly.
To replace the front audio and USB assembly, do the following:
1. Turn off the computer and disconnect all power cords from electrical outlets.
2. Remove the computer cover. See "Removing the computer cover" on page 79.
3. Remove the front bezel. See "Removing and reinstalling the front bezel" on page 80.
4. Locate the front audio and USB assembly. See "Locating components" on page 76.
5. Disconnect the front audio and USB assembly cables from the system board. See "Locating parts on
the system board" on page 77.
